To Attach Base

Step 1.

Place base on floor with wheels

down.

Step 2.

Open tubes of tray assembly

as shown until they latch.

Step 3.

Front tube has plastic “T” ends.

Tilt tray assembly as shown.

Insert one plastic “T” into slot

on the inside front of the base.

Repeat on opposite side, flexing

tube inward if needed to

engage the slot.

Step 4.

Lower rear tube so holes

in ends of tube line up with

two holes in back of activity

center base.
Be sure that plastic “T” pieces

remain in their slots.

Step 5.

Insert pin into hole

as shown, through

tray tube, and out

through base hole

on the other side.

Press firmly until tab

snaps over head of pin.

Repeat on other side.
Be sure all parts of tray

and base are securely

fastened, with “T” pieces

in their slots and tabs

holding pins firmly.

Step 1.

To raise your activity center,

hold the base with one hand

while lifting the tray with the

other hand.
Adjust the tray so that it is no

lower than waist level when

your child is standing in the

activity center.

Step 2.

To lower (or fold) your activity

center, reach underneath the

tray and squeeze the finger

latches, holding them in

while you lower the tray.

Tray should lower easily.

DO NOT force tray down or

unit could be damaged.

Caring for the Activity Center

Make sure five friction strips under base are kept

clean. Clean with water only.
For cleaning vinyl seat, metal and plastic parts

other than friction strips, use only household soap

or detergent and warm water. NO BLEACH.
Excessive exposure to sun or heat could cause

fading or warping of parts.
